Transaction 28c055976b23919c0bb1068c531b194669336ac57d53cebdd9ef04e52faeaf66
1 Input
1 Output
-
28c055976b23919c0bb1068c531b194669336ac57d53cebdd9ef04e52faeaf66:0
- value
- 654435400
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ea6680d8051cdd7294af89d44ae47cff321999d OP_EQUALVERIFY OP_CHECKSIG
- address
- 16iGF1yLd59xTks6NzkpGBfjSi8fAV4vuG